NIMCET 2026 Registration Begins For MCA Admission, Here's Direct Link To Apply

The National Institute of Technology (NIT) has officially commenced the registration process for the NIMCET 2026, the entrance examination for Master of Computer Applications (MCA) admissions. Interested candidates can apply through the designated online portal starting now. The examination is scheduled to take place on June 6, 2026, from 2 PM to 4 PM, utilizing a computer-based testing format. This exam is significant for aspirants seeking admission to various NITs across India, making it a crucial step for their academic and professional future.
